
The three-level SCC Main Building is distinguished by its glass-like stairwell "tower," triangular windows and other interesting architectural focal points. The building houses classrooms, labs, administrative offices and faculty suites.
About 100,000 square feet, the SCC Main Building is the largest of the four buildings in Phase 1 of campus construction completed in late 1991.
* Formerly the Administration Building.

Conoyer Hall (12-CH)/Daniel J. Conoyer Social Sciences Building
This two-story building houses a number of classrooms, an auditorium, administrative offices including the president of the college, and the departments of admissions, financial aid and advising-all located on the second floor.
* Formerly Social Science Building
